Turnigy SCT 2wd 1/10 – Option Parts
After building the Turnigy SCT 2wd 1/10 V2 Kit last year I spotted some areas I thought may be a little weak, e.g. front and rear suspension arm holding blocks. I looked into some alloy upgrades but annoyingly they were a) only available in the International Warehouse and b) Always on backorder.
I finally managed to get some Turnigy bits for the rear end but the main bit I wanted, the front bulkhead (lower suspension arm holding block) was always on back order.
I researched a few times and kept seeing posts which say the Turnigy SCT 2wd is a copy of the Kyosho Ultima SC. People suggest trying the front bulkhead as it might fit; I could never see anything which said someone had tried it though.
I found an ST Racing Concepts Aluminium front Bulkhead on ebay, for the Kyosho Ultima SC. It was $8, from the USA and had something like £1.50 postage. I took a punt. Worst case scenario I could stick it back on ebay and tell the world it didn’t fit.
However it fits perfectly. The Turnigy SCT is blatently a full on copy of the 4x more expensive Kyosho Ultima SC.
There are tonnes of aftermarket spares for Kyosho cars, both by Kyosho and other manufacturers. The best thing is they are readily available and you can order them in from the USA or Europe and don’t have to wait 3 weeks for them to come from Hong Kong.
The ST Racing Concepts aftermarket Bulkhead has a grub screw for each hinge pin which stops it moving about as that whole front end design is a bit flawed, I often had a pin become dislodge after a heavy front end impact.
